What is IEC EN 61000-3-3:2013?

IEC EN 61000-3-3:2013 is a standard that falls under the category of Electromagnetic Compatibility (EMC). It specifies the limits and measurement methods for voltage fluctuations and flicker caused by equipment connected to low-voltage power supply systems. This standard provides guidelines to ensure that electrical and electronic equipment do not excessively disrupt the normal functioning of other devices.

Understanding Voltage Fluctuations and Flicker

Voltage fluctuations refer to the variations in the steady-state voltage level provided by the power supply. These can occur due to load changes, starting or stopping of equipment, or other electrically "noisy" operations. Flicker, on the other hand, is a visual annoyance that arises when the lighting intensity repeatedly changes rapidly, often as a result of voltage fluctuations.

High levels of voltage fluctuations and flicker can have detrimental effects on sensitive electrical and electronic equipment. They can lead to malfunctioning or incorrect operation of devices and can even cause safety hazards in certain situations. Therefore, it is crucial to establish limits and guidelines to prevent these issues.

IEC EN 61000-3-3:2013 Requirements

The IEC EN 61000-3-3:2013 standard sets out the requirements for permitted voltage fluctuations and flicker levels. It defines various classes and the maximum allowable values for each class, depending on the type of equipment used and the location of the installation.

The standard also outlines the measurement methods and instrumentation necessary for evaluating voltage fluctuations and flicker. By adhering to these methods, manufacturers, installers, and users of electrical and electronic equipment can ensure compliance with the standard and prevent potential issues related to EMC.
